Area information of Oshiage

Station overview

Oshiage is in Tokyo's Sumida ward, on the Keisei Oshiage, Toei Asakusa, Metro Hanzomon, and Tobu Sky Tree lines. It opened in 1912, and was put underground in 1960. From 2012, it is the closest station to Sky Tree. On the Keisei and Toei platforms, 1 and 2 head toward Asakusa, Higashi-Ginza and Shinbashi. Oshiage line platforms 3 and 4 head toward Aoto and Funabashi. On Metro and Tobu platforms: 1 through 3 are Hanzomon lines headed toward Otemachi, Shibuya, and Chuo Rinkan, while platform 4 takes Sky Tree lines to Kita-Senju and Koshigaya. Average daily ridership is 216,517 for the Keisei, 219,904 for the Asakusa line, 177,297 for the Hanzomon, and 103,102 for Tobu.

Places to see

The Oshiage station area has seen a massive amount of recent redevelopment, and Tokyo Sky Tree and Solamachi are not to be missed. Sky Tree is a 634-meter tall building with an incredible view from the various decks. Solamachi is made up of floors B3 to 31, and the part of the building that makes up the "roots" of Sky Treet are filled with all sorts of stores and gift shops, many with Disney or Pokemon characters. There is also a museum, and a planetarium, as well as a plethora of places to eat good food, from high-end restaurants to food courts.

Lifestyle

Thanks to Tokyo Sky Tree, Oshiage station has become a very convenient place, thanks to its placement on several train lines. You can also use nearby buses. You will never be bored of shopping thanks to Tokyo Solamachi. The station now also has considerable name value. There are many supermarkets, and you can still find nice Japanese neighborhoods away from Sky Tree. Plus you can find drug stores, 100 yen stores, fashion shops, and more. It's a popular area for people of all ages.
